DRFC Dickov disgusted with performance

Doncaster Rovers boss Paul Dickov says he was disgusted with the performance after seeing his side crash out of the FA Cup.

Rovers were beaten 3-2 at home by Stevenage, who are at the foot of League One and Dickov says he couldn`t defend his players after the performance.

Speaking on BBC Radio Sheffield, “I am disgusted with the performance. I put a side out there we felt should win the game but we never looked to pass or press the ball like we usually do.

“I am not going to defend the players like I usually back the players all the way but I am not going to after that performance.

“The most disappointing thing is, they looked like they wanted it far more than us.”


Rovers never recovered after a mistake by Paul Quinn led to Francois Zoko firing Stevenage ahead early in the second half.

Peter Hartley doubled the lead for Stevenage when an aerial ball into the middle once again undid Rovers.

Harry Forrest gave Rovers some hope when he reduced the arrears but Darius Charles scored a third for Stevenage in injury time.

Liam Wakefield pulled another goal back for Rovers but it was all too little too late as Rovers crashed out of the competition.
